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
902 405713879 22631581055
072 75552
072 75552
6963 844871 0411893 9693163010
All about undefined
Interested in learning more?
072 75552
6963 844871 0411893 9693163010
See more
6532 788260 74511993424
3718 741353614 3129
See more
79 88525189596
499 0274 9835703
See more